Author: MINISTRY OF NATIONAL DEVELOPMENT PLANNING/BAPPENAS Category: PBI Published: 2021 Country: Indonesia Language: English DownloadBuilding climate resilience in Indonesia is focused on four sectors affected by climate change: Marine and Coastal Sector, in the potential hazard of the increased wave height and sea level which results in inundation or flooding in the coastal areas; Agriculture Sector, in the potential decrease of rice production; Water Sector, in the potential increase of the frequency of drought and the potential decrease of water availability; and Health Sector, in the increase indicative outbreak of DHF, malaria, and pneumonia diseases. Climate change impacts are spread throughout Indonesia with different risk levels according to the hazard, vulnerability, and climate resilience capacity of the environment and its communities. Increasing climate resilience through specific activities at the location of climate resilience action interventions aims to reduce vulnerability and strengthen the capacity for communities. Therefore, people can withstand the impacts of climate change. The locations for climate resilience interventions are the priority locations for climate resilience activities, categorized into three levels, super-priority, top-priority, and priority, based on the level of hazard, vulnerability, and the risk of potential disasters
